Output 8d3f4e26a3f8ca479d4d1e154b5e446cb0e6d7e1c62f685285bebace2e480563:13

value
25475900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decd302d5a6eca3b89911c7ed27b256dce42e70 OP_EQUAL
address
3LTr9hyEDdLsQUjPqZa66rmr1ALhtvwS8i
transaction
8d3f4e26a3f8ca479d4d1e154b5e446cb0e6d7e1c62f685285bebace2e480563
spent
true